TBF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review

83 of the 6,221 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in ProShares Short 20+ Year Treasury ETF (TBF)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$85.7M — down 53% from $184M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 29 funds closed out of TBF and 20 opened new positions — a net loss of 9 holders — while 27 trimmed existing stakes and 16 added.

The largest buyer was Jane Street, opening a new position worth an estimated $3.49M. The largest seller was Q3 Asset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$24.2M sold.
